How to read the semen routine test report

  We often find in our male clinics that some patients are anxious to know if their situation is good and if they can make their female partner pregnant after they get their first routine semen test report. In fact, it is too early to draw a conclusion at this point. We know that the condition of male semen is greatly influenced by other factors, such as the interval between semen extraction and the last ejaculation, the presence of sauna 2 weeks before semen extraction, the presence of drugs that affect sperm vitality, the personnel and machines used for the examination, etc. Scientists have also found that the indicators of male semen fluctuate greatly throughout the year, so a single semen examination sometimes cannot fully and correctly reflect the true condition of semen. Therefore, a single semen examination sometimes does not reflect the true condition of semen. For this reason, the World Health Organization specifically requires that semen routine tests be performed more than 2-3 times in a row within 2 weeks before a diagnosis can be made based on the results. Therefore, we should not jump to conclusions after getting the report, especially if the results are abnormal, sometimes it takes 3 consecutive times before we can make a definite diagnosis.
